Output 32587e8c5b34edec4e64a0141663c745cd4d4ed547eeb36eeceeb786f19cecf3:42

value
752873798
script pubkey
OP_0 OP_PUSHBYTES_20 bdb8dfea716d4650b466d2fd43621db5ccb56f46
address
bc1qhkudl6n3d4r9pdrx6t75xcsakhxt2m6xl69pur
transaction
32587e8c5b34edec4e64a0141663c745cd4d4ed547eeb36eeceeb786f19cecf3
spent
true